GBU-24A/B is the perfect weapon for that job and result, and the one used here to produce that shots. AGM-65G is designed for the same job too, but the db values have to be cross-checked for weapons and shelters strength and % of damage or kill.
But, the results which are in question by you apply to real world and not a simulator and bms specifically, at least for now. What I mean is that in real, depending the penetration angle the weapon is going to hit a shelter it might only do a small whole and penetrate the internal, exploding on the inside, or collapse a bigger part of the shelter structure and again explode inside. Then, what will happen / what overall damage will be produced and what the recce photos will show later, is again depending of what is inside the shelter at the time of the explosion. What real documentation analysis state is that if there is a unfueled and unarmed plane just sitting within the shelter, the overall power and detonation pressure force will be less than if the shelter was completely empty. But if there is a fueled and armed plane inside there, specially using a2g ordinance, the results would be devastating for the whole shelter structure.
In Falcon there are only 3 categories for models, 1. OK, 2. Damaged, 3. Destroyed. The shelters are created by JanHas after dozens of hours researching all data, photos and documentation, including the site you proposed, and are modeled exactly with these in mind. The damaged state will only alternate the external shelter skins, eg if you fire some Mk-82 bombs they will only damaged the external surface and painting, but in the destroyed state they will turn like my pictures here, as they would include armed planes inside, or, if you hit the shelter with 2 penetration weapons.
Bottom line, the modelling results are astonishing, and if Falcon allowed further modelling we could easily have more states or destruction results.

The package would be only the “Data” folder of the sim, containing all beneath subfolders and modifications to both db, models, skins and individual files. So no need to install something, only a 1-folder copy-paste to any original 4.32u7 installation.
About 4.33 I am sure that this mod would not be compatible because as logic states, the extensive work done by both the bms devs on .33 as and me on this mod would mess things up. I have populated the db with more than 250 models, skins and plates, multiplexed to have single-seat and two-seat planes in realistically designed squadrons, working captive weapons, new sam and ship air-defense implementations, updated db smaller values… All these would not pass to a new version simply like that without braking more stuff, most would need again work from 0 to reach this level and of course evaluating the new stuff that .33 will bring.
